2 Timothy 3:7-13 Lexham English Bible (LEB)

7. always learning and never able to come to a knowledge of the truth.

8. And just as Jannes and Jambres opposed Moses, so also these oppose the truth, people corrupted in mind, disqualified concerning the faith.

9. But they will not progress to a greater extent, for their folly will be quite evident to everyone, as also the folly of those two was.

10. But you have faithfully followed my teaching, way of life, purpose, faith, patience, love, endurance,

11. persecutions, and sufferings that happened to me in Antioch, in Iconium, and in Lystra, what sort of persecutions I endured, and the Lord delivered me from all of them.

12. And indeed, all those who want to live in a godly manner in Christ Jesus will be persecuted.

13. But evil people and imposters will progress to the worse, deceiving and being deceived.
